开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

spark连接odps,执行insert overwrite报错

报错信息:ErrorCode=OverwriteModeNotAllowed, ErrorMessage=Overwrite mode not enabled in project:xxxx。在dataworks中该项目是可以执行insert overwrite的。我这个是maxcompute-spark本地模式。

image.png

展开
收起
游客wbg2in6suqdus 2022-08-18 21:31:12 909 0
1 条回答
写回答
取消 提交回答
  • 个错误信息意味着在您的MaxCompute-Spark本地模式中,无法执行overwrite操作。这是由于MaxCompute-Spark的本地模式默认不启用overwrite操作,只能在云模式下启用。 在本地模式下,您需要通过设置Spark的配置参数来启用overwrite操作。以下是可以在本地模式下启用overwrite操作的一些参数:

    spark.sql.sources.first.overwrite:设置为true,可以在创建表时强制创建表。
    spark.sql.warehouse.dir:设置为本地文件路径,可以将数据保存在本地文件中。
    
    2023-06-16 14:55:58
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

热门讨论

热门文章

相关电子书

更多
Data+AI时代大数据平台应该如何建设 立即下载
大数据AI一体化的解读 立即下载
极氪大数据 Serverless 应用实践 立即下载